Obituary for Lucille Walker
Lucille passed peacefully from this life the afternoon of April 30th. She was surrounded and supported by her loving family and friends. She was born on May 14, 1951 in Twin Groves, AR (Solomon Grove community). She was preceded in death by her parents Minister Robert Y.C. and Cozetta (Jones) Walker; three sisters and six brothers.Â
Lucille was a teacher for 32 years in the Fort Worth Independent School District and also Arkansas. She received a Bachelor of Science Degree in Education from the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ff. She was a faithful member of Pilgrim Valley Missionary Baptist Church where she supported the youth department and drill team. In addition, she was an active member of the Health Awareness Team.
